It’s January, so cold weather and snow are inevitable. The Island, however offers plenty of events to keep the winter blues at bay.
Dine in or take out at the Good Shepherd Parish Community Supper on Thursday.
Also on Thursday, enjoy a Prime Rib Night at the Black Dog Tavern.
Step aboard a 19th-century whaleship through the pages of a logbook on Friday at the MV Museum.
For Island writers, learn how to demystify literary journal submissions on Saturday at Featherstone.
Also on Saturday, create a vision board for 2026 at the Edgartown Library, or join writer Don Hinkle at the Oak Bluffs Library, speaking about his lifelong career and misadventures.
